Abstract

The aim of the work was to determine the anti-inflammatory effectiveness of the use of a complex of natural cytokines and antimicrobial peptides (Superlimf) in the treatment of patients with mild chronic generalized periodontitis.
 Materials and methods: 60 patients were randomized into 2 equal groups. Patients of both groups were removed dental deposits using the Piezon-Master-400 ultrasound machine and the surfaces of the roots of the teeth were polished using periodontal bores (SRP — Scaling, Root Planning), taught the rules of oral hygiene with subsequent three-time control. Resorbable plates of the Superlimf preparation were additionally applied to the gum in the patients of the main group. To assess the intensity of inflammation in periodontal tissues, the clinical indices of Muhlemann and PMA were used.
 Results: The dynamics of the clinical indices of Mulleman and PMA before treatment, 7 days later and 21 days after treatment showed a statistically significant more pronounced anti-inflammatory effect in patients in the main group who were treated with Superlimf in addition to SPR.
 Conclusions: Local use of the drug Superlimf in combination with SRP increases the effect of anti-inflammatory treatment of patients with mild chronic generalized periodontitis.
